Solid fiberglass rods are made by pulling the fibers through a resin bath and then forming them into a shape. These rods are very strong and can be made in a variety of shapes, including solid rods, tubes, bars, ovals, channels, half rounds, and tees. Hollow fiberglass rods are also manufactured by pulling the fibers through a resin Bath and then forming them into a shape. They're used in a variety of applications, such as marine, electrical, and construction industries. Pultruded fiberglass rods are another specialized type of rod, created by pulling the fibers through a resin system and then through a heated die to form them into a shape. These rods offer many advantages over solid and hollow fiberglass rods, including their strength, flexibility, and ability to be shaped into virtually any shape. Compared to steel, custom fiberglass rods can be as much as 75% lighter without sacrificing any strength. This can make them an ideal solution for a wide variety of applications, including radio and radar applications. It's also very low in thermal conductivity and highly corrosion-resistant, making it an ideal choice for a variety of other high-performance applications. The benefits of pultruded fiberglass are numerous, and they're often more cost-effective than steel. They're non-conductive both thermally and electrically, can be molded into various shapes, and they don't interfere with EMI/RFI or radio wave transmissions. They're also very light and can be manufactured with simple tools, so they're easier to handle and install. The main benefits of pultruded fiberglass are its long-term cost savings, which can be realized by reducing the amount of money needed to replace corroded or oxidized materials. They're also extremely durable, so they can withstand years of exposure to weather and other environmental conditions.
